Output 690125628be29ad922466681f924da2ebacb847a99d4fe30e9181b051c75480f:2

value
531
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c588172ab8b650a9d38ef3e6867ec359459ea0cd0eac0e200068092204b58caf
address
bc1pckypw24ckeg2n5uw70ngvlkrt9zeagxdp6kqugqqdqyjyp943jhsy80lgf
transaction
690125628be29ad922466681f924da2ebacb847a99d4fe30e9181b051c75480f
spent
true